Dumpster Size Selection



When selecting a dumpster dimension, consider the quantity of waste you require to take care of and the area offered on your property. It's essential to accurately approximate the quantity of particles you'll be disposing of to guarantee you select a dumpster that can accommodate all of it. If you opt for a size that's too small, you might end up requiring multiple journeys to the garbage dump or extra pickups, bring about added costs and aggravation.

On the other hand, selecting a dumpster that's as well big for your demands can be a waste of money and beneficial space on your building.

To establish the right size, analyze the kind and quantity of products you'll be dealing with. For small cleanouts or remodellings, a 10-yard dumpster may be enough. For larger projects like whole-home cleanouts or building and construction, you may need a 20 or 30-yard dumpster. By evaluating your waste quantity and readily available area, you can choose the appropriate dumpster dimension to efficiently handle your cleaning needs.

Waste Disposal Guidelines



Prior to you start dealing with waste in the rented out dumpster, it's important to adhere to details guidelines to guarantee appropriate and effective disposal.

First, segregate your waste right into groups such as recyclables, natural waste, and general trash. This will certainly make disposal easier and extra eco-friendly.

Bear in mind any harmful products that are restricted from being dumped in the dumpster, such as chemicals, batteries, or electronic devices. These products need unique disposal techniques to prevent damage to the setting and public health.

Additionally, stay clear of overfilling the dumpster past its capability limitation, as this can present security dangers during transport.

Understand the weight restricts set by the rental company and avoid exceeding them to prevent added charges or complications.
